This, my friend, was an unexpectedly pleasant place. I never knew of this place until I saw smitty’s rating. Decent selection of singles in coolers, tho the price is high, its about average for this locale. I found some singles there I never tasted before. The owner or manager let me have a couple of free samples from the growler taps. Easy to find with lots of parking. Satuyrday evening when I was there, they had an outdoor BBQ going on, smelled great. Owner manager seemed to be very knowledgeable about beer.
